How do I change units in AutoCAD?

1. Click Utilities Drawing Setup.

2. Click the Units tab.

3. Under Drawing Units, select the desired units.

4. To scale objects that you insert into the current drawing from drawings with different drawing units, select Scale Objects Inserted from Other Drawings.

5. Under Length, select a unit type and desired precision.

How do I change units to mm in AutoCAD?

1. Open AutoCAD Architecture or AutoCAD MEP and start a new blank drawing.

2. Enter UNITS command to bring up the “Drawing Setup” dialog box.

3. Once there, change “Units” to “Millimeters” or “Meters”.

4. Check the box next to “Save as Default” in the bottom left of the dialog box.

How do I change units to CM in AutoCAD?

1. Click Home tab Modify panel Scale. Find.

2. At the Select Objects prompt, enter all.

3. Enter a base point of *0,0. Scaling will be relative to the world coordinate system (WCS) origin and the location of the drawing origin will remain at the WCS origin.

4. Enter the scale factor.

What is Insunits?

Specifies a drawing-units value for automatic scaling of blocks, images, or xrefs when inserted or attached to a drawing.29 mar. 2020

What is xref command in AutoCAD?

An XRef is an ‘external reference’ to another AutoCAD drawing file. One file can reference many other files and display them as if they were one. These are used in larger projects for many reasons: They keep the file sizes down. They allow many users to work on individual components of a project.

How do you attach xrefs in AutoCAD?

1. Click Insert tab Reference panel Attach. Find.

2. In the Select Reference File dialog box, select one or more files you want to attach and then click Open.

3. In the Attach External Reference dialog box, under Reference Type, select Attachment.

4. Specify the insertion point, scale, and rotation angle.

5. Click OK.

How do I change inches to mm in AutoCAD?

1. On the Dimension menu, click Style.

2. In the Dimension Style Manager, click New.

3. In the New Dimension Style dialog box, select a Name, Start With Style, and select Use For: All Dimensions.

4. On the Primary Units tab, enter mm in the Suffix box and set the Scale Factor to 25.4 (there are 25.4 mm per inch).

How do I set units and limits in AutoCAD?

1. Open the AutoCAD software.

2. Type LIMITS on the command line or command prompt.

3. Press Enter or spacebar.

4. Write the coordinates of the lower-left corner. For example, (0,0).

5. Press Enter.

6. Write the coordinates of the upper-right corner. For example, (200, 200).

7. Press Enter.

8. Write Z.
